    Hi folks back to the KF ...
    One from the third session , when the male arrived at that location .


    Canon EOS R3
    EF 200 - 400 IS L at 400 mm
    Tripod

    F 5,6 ; Iso 12.800 ; 1/2500 sec

    Processed with Capture One and PSCC 2023 ; cropped for comp .
    I am not 100 % about the crop , as the issue is that it was shot in portrait ... so I have lots of dead space ... but it is too tight for horizontal . So I went for a compromise . Could have also gone to 4X5 ... but found that too tight.
